**FAQ: How do I investigate cron drift on Pellwick?**

Cron drift on the Pellwick scheduler usually means the host clock on node group Tarnby fell out of sync. Compare the job's expected fire time against the ledger in Driftwatch, then resync chrony. To open the Driftwatch admin console as a contractor, enter the recovery passphrase shown below:

unlock words, hahip-baduf: holwyn-istath-julvan

Ticket: DiffHarbor — intermittent connection failures when loading large-file diffs

Since the 4.2 rollout, DiffHarbor's side-by-side viewer drops its backend connection on files over 80 MB, roughly one in five attempts. Retries succeed, so we suspect pool exhaustion rather than network faults. Priya has reproduced it on the Kestrelworks staging cluster. For verification before the release cut, connect using the string below.

primary connection of yagep-kahip = redis://giliel_svc:zYiKsLL2PLpfPL@db-348f.xolmarsys.corp:5432/fenwyn

**Q: How do I import a catalogue batch into Shelfwright?**

Use the `shelfwright import` command with the MARC export from the source branch. Validation runs automatically; rejected records land in the quarantine queue. Do not re-run imports on failure without checking the queue first. Step-by-step instructions are on the internal import guide page.

runbook for tafof-yawif: https://confluence.tolvaqsys.internal/display/display/browse/pages/7be3

Key Ceremony Checklist — Item 7 (Broker Recovery)

Contractor task: verify log compaction on the Ferrowick message queue before sealing keys. Confirm compaction ran on all partitions of the audit topic. Check retained offsets match the ledger snapshot. If compaction lag exceeds threshold, halt the ceremony and notify the custodian on duty. Do not proceed with key escrow until compacted segments are checksummed. Record results on the paper log. The escrow locker opens only with the passphrase printed below.

vault phrase of bagaf-kajeg = jorath-feniel-briir-siliel-ralix